Foods from a refrigerator or freezer can be used in an emergency. You can extend the shelf life of food in a freezer if you have enough notice about a potential power outage. Fill plastic containers or jugs clean with water and freeze. Food will last up to 3 days in a well-insulated and well-filled closed freezer You should have enough food to last three days if you have to evacuate because of a disaster or other similar circumstances. To clean surfaces and equipment used in food preparation, as well as the inside of refrigerators or freezers, use 2 teaspoons (or more) of chlorine bleach in a quart of warm water. Foods in cans or containers may look undamaged, but heat from a fire may have activated food poisoning bacteria. Flood waters can carry disease bacteria and filth that can contaminate food or water, making it unsafe to eat.

Do It Yourself emergency food supply?

 

The square containers and buckets don't seal tightly and the food inside is divided into pouches. If the pouches do not have sufficient quality and materials, the oxygen could leak and cause food to become stale. Many manufacturers don’t even use oxygen absorbers in their packaging. This packaging is "stackable", but it also wastes a lot space in each bucket. The floor space required by a 1-year unit will be five times larger that the #10 hard sided cans. Consider buying pantry items in cans if you live in an area that is at high risk of flooding. They are less likely to get contaminated by floodwaters than jars.

Honey is known to be one of the only foods that can last forever. This is largely due to the fact that it is made up of sugar, which makes it hard for bacteria or microorganisms to affect the honey. Jul 2, 2019

There's a reason beef jerky is considered the best survival food — it offers high protein in a nutrient dense package. Protein can be one of the most difficult nutrition sources to find in emergency food kits, and that's why beef jerky is a great addition. Aug 18, 2021

If you are planning on storing food for a natural disaster or an emergency, you should store at least a gallon of water and 2000 calories of food for each day for a single person, according to FEMA (Federal Emergency Management Agency). Jun 10, 2022
